Description
The AddOn XFP-10GB-DW54-80-AO is a high-performance, MSA-compliant 10GBase-DWDM XFP transceiver designed for long-haul single-mode fiber applications up to 80 km. Operating on a 1534.25 nm wavelength (Channel 54, 100 GHz ITU grid), this hot-pluggable module ensures seamless integration into enterprise, metro, and access networks.
It features a temperature-stabilized EML transmitter, APD receiver, duplex LC connector, and supports Digital Optical Monitoring (DOM) for real-time diagnostics. With RoHS compliance, TAA certification, and robust ESD/EMI protection, this transceiver delivers reliable, carrier-grade performance.
Ideal for 10 Gigabit Ethernet DWDM links and Fibre Channel applications, the XFP-10GB-DW54-80-AO is uniquely serialized, extensively tested, and backed by AddOnβs limited lifetime warranty for assured network compatibility and dependability.
| Specification | Details |
|---|---|
| Form Factor | XFP (Hot-Pluggable) |
| Data Rate | Up to 11.3 Gbps |
| Reach/Distance | Up to 80 km |
| Wavelength | 1534.25 nm (DWDM Channel 54, ITU-T Grid 100 GHz) |
| Connector | Duplex LC |
| Fiber Type | Single-Mode Fiber (SMF) |
| Transmitter Type | Temperature-stabilized EML |
| Receiver Type | APD |
| Optical Power Output | 0 to +5 dBm |
| Receiver Sensitivity | -23 dBm |
| Receiver Overload | -8 dBm |
| Power Supply | +3.3V, +5V |
| Power Consumption | β€ 3.5 W |
| Operating Temperature | 0Β°C to 70Β°C (Commercial) |
| Compliance | INF-8077i, RoHS, TAA |
| Monitoring | Digital Optical Monitoring (DOM) |
| Warranty | Limited Lifetime Warranty |
